About the Organization

The International Foodservice Distributors Association (IFDA) is a U.S.-based trade association representing foodservice distribution companies and their supplier partners; it advances the interests of distributors through advocacy, industry research, education, training, and development of best practices to support safe, efficient and sustainable foodservice supply chains.

Policy Goals

Typically pursues policies affecting food safety and traceability, supply chain and transportation regulation, workforce development and labor issues, tax and trade policy, public procurement and contracting, regulatory compliance and relief for distributors, and sustainability and food waste reduction initiatives.

Funding

Primarily funded by membership dues from distributor and supplier member companies, sponsorships and exhibit fees, events and conferences, and revenue from fee-based programs and publications.

Affiliates

National Restaurant Association, Food Marketing Institute, National Association of Wholesaler-Distributors, state and regional distributor associations, and major industry members such as Sysco and US Foods.

Legal Structure

Non-profit trade association
